Does acrylic paint work as fabric paint?

Yes, acrylic paint can be used as fabric paint, but there are some things to consider before using it. Acrylic paint works well on absorbent materials such as cotton, denim, and canvas. However, it’s important to note that acrylic paint is permanent.

Once it’s dry, it can’t be washed off or removed from the fabric. Therefore, you should use it with caution on fabrics that you don’t want to become stained permanently.

Also, you should keep in mind that acrylic paint isn’t very flexible and can crack if the fabric is bent and stretched. To prevent this, you can use textile medium, which helps to make the paint more flexible and durable.

Furthermore, to ensure that the paint doesn’t crack, you should iron the project after painting it and let it cool before using it.

Finally, it’s important to read the instructions on the paint before using it, as it may require a certain number of layers before it’s truly heat resistant and durable.
